# ScanBridge — Environments

ScanBridge integrates handheld barcode scanners with the Varnholt inventory backend.

**Dev:** synthetic scan feeds only, no customer data.

**Staging:** mirrors prod topology; scanner firmware updates tested here first. Access restricted to the integrations group.

**Prod:** live scan traffic from warehouse floors in Drennick and Oslov. All inbound payloads are signed; unsigned frames are dropped and logged.

Secrets rotate quarterly. Each environment boots from the configuration values below.

settings of fafog-haduf:
ZORIX_PIN=4648
ZORIX_METRICS_HOST=metrics.zorix.paliqsys.corp
ZORIX_LOG_LEVEL=info
ZORIX_TENANT=druix

## Brightmart Pilot — Managers Only

Quick update for the board: our shelf-analytics pilot with the Brightmart retail chain is live in six stores across the Calder Valley region. Early read-outs look promising — stockout alerts are landing within minutes, and store managers seem genuinely keen. Contract talks for a wider rollout start next month. Before then, please review the note below.

internal memo for kawip-hadug: Headcount on the Wenwyn team goes from 7 to 140 by the end of January. Gross margin on Wenwyn came in at 20 percent against a plan of 15 percent.

## Data Stores — PixelVault Image Cache

Plugin authors: the thumbnail cache leaks when eviction callbacks retain decoded buffers, so always release handles in `onEvict`. Cache metadata lives in a dedicated Postgres instance; blobs stay on disk. For local testing against our sandbox metadata store, configure your plugin with the connection string below.

primary connection of tajeg-tajop = postgresql://julax_svc:DI@db-e7f3.kelvidyn.corp:5432/rusdor

Facilities Ticket — Cleaning Crew Access, Brindle Annex

For new starters handling evening lock-up: the Sorano Cleaning crew arrives nightly at 21:30 via the annex side door. Check their rota sheet, note arrival in the log, and ensure the storeroom is relocked afterward. To let them through the side door, enter the access code below.

badge for yaweg-hafog: bdg-GX-6